IG Of Police Force Appoints New CP For Rivers State
New CP Olatunji Disu appointed to head Rivers State Command
Olatunji Disu, the Commissioner of Police (CP), has been named as the new leader of the Rivers State police command by Inspector General of Police (IGP) Kayode Egbetokun.
In an effort to bolster security, prevent violent crime, and improve coordination, the IGP has also redeployed seven additional senior police officers to other commands around the nation.
The other CPs appointed or redeployed include CP George Chuku to Bayelsa State Command, CP Ahmed Tijani to Jigawa State Command, CP Dan Shawulu to Niger State Command, CP Usman Hayatu to Gombe State Command, CP Danjuma Aboki to Imo State Command, CP Isyaku Muhammed to Ondo State Command, and others.
The redeployments were announced with a police signal and went into action right away. The IGP gave the CPs instructions in the signal to demonstrate their professional competence in their new leadership positions.
Disu was appointed just three days after young people in Rivers state staged a protest and demanded that the previous Commissioner of Police, Nwonyi Emeka, be redeployed. The protest was sparked by rumors that some police officers had shot and threatened Governor Siminalaye Fubara while he was assessing the damage caused by a fire that had destroyed the state's House of Assembly chambers.
